Common Methods of Alcohol Testing

  • Breathalyzer
  • Blood test
  • Saliva test
  • Urine test
  • Hair analysis

Breathalyzer - Used for immediate alcohol level evaluation.

Blood test - Provides precise BAC readings for legal cases.

Saliva test - Quick, non-invasive method for recent alcohol use.

Urine test - Detects alcohol consumption over a longer period.

Hair analysis - Reflects long-term alcohol consumption patterns.

What is the Detection Window for Fingernail Drug Tests

  • Fingernails: Effective for detecting drug use over the last 3-6 months.
  • Toenails: May show drug intake spanning 6-12 months.

Common Types of Occupational Health Tests

  • Fitness for duty exams: Assesses if employees are physically able to perform job tasks.
  • Respirator Fit Testing: Ensures respirators fit correctly, protecting against harmful substances.
  • Pulmonary Function Tests (PFT's): Evaluates lung function related to workplace exposures.
  • Tuberculosis (TB) tests: Screens for TB infection, crucial in healthcare settings.
  • Vision testing: Checks for sight issues affecting job performance.
  • Audiometric testing: Monitors hearing ability to prevent noise-induced loss.

If an initial screen is not negative, the sample goes through confirmatory testing using more specific analytical methods. Final results are not reported until confirmation is complete to ensure accuracy and defensibility.
Yes. Accredited Drug Testing offers on-site/mobile collections for employers. Mobile collections reduce employee downtime, are useful for job sites and remote work locations, and are critical for immediate post-incident or reasonable suspicion situations.
Common specimen types include urine, hair, saliva/oral fluid, and breath (for alcohol). Each method supports different needs: urine is widely used for workplace testing, hair provides a longer detection history, saliva/oral fluid can capture more recent use, and breath alcohol testing measures current alcohol concentration.
